Chicago woman admits guilt, sentenced to 50 years for cutting baby from victim’s womb

April 18, 2024No Comments3 Mins Read
Facebook Twitter Pinterest LinkedIn Telegram Email WhatsApp Copy Link

Clarisa Figueroa, a Chicago woman, pleaded guilty to murder on Tuesday for luring a pregnant teenager to her home and cutting her baby from her womb nearly five years ago. She was sentenced to 50 years in prison, with no possibility of parole. The victim, Marlen Ochoa-Lopez, was strangled with a cable by Figueroa, who then called 911 claiming she had given birth. The baby died about two months later, leaving the victim’s husband, Yovanny Lopez, devastated.

Authorities revealed that Figueroa had plotted for months to acquire a newborn after the death of her adult son, and even posted ultrasound photos and images of a baby room on Facebook. She connected with Ochoa-Lopez on a Facebook page for pregnant women, luring her to her home under false pretenses. Ochoa-Lopez’s body was later found in a garbage can outside Figueroa’s home, while DNA tests confirmed that the child was not biologically related to Figueroa.

Desiree Figueroa, Clarisa’s daughter, played a role in the crime and pleaded guilty to murder in January. She was sentenced to 30 years in prison and agreed to testify against her mother. Clarisa’s boyfriend, Piotr Bobak, was also involved in the cover-up of the crime scene and was sentenced to four years in prison for obstruction of justice. Yovanny Lopez, the victim’s husband, expressed his pain in court, stating that the memory of his son’s last breath in his arms was unbearable.

The case shocked the Chicago community and sparked outrage over the heinous crime. Authorities expressed hope that justice would be served for the victim and her family. The sentencing of Clarisa Figueroa to 50 years in prison was seen as a small measure of closure for the tragedy that had unfolded. The judge emphasized that Figueroa would serve the entire sentence without the possibility of early release, ensuring that she would not harm anyone else.

Despite the horrific nature of the crime, the community came together to support the victim’s family and seek justice for Marlen Ochoa-Lopez. The story of her tragic death at the hands of individuals who had plotted to steal her baby highlighted the importance of vigilance and awareness in protecting vulnerable individuals. The sentencing of Figueroa and her accomplices served as a reminder that such acts of violence would not be tolerated in society, sending a strong message to those who seek to harm others for their own gain.

The case of Marlen Ochoa-Lopez’s murder and the kidnapping of her baby left a lasting impact on the community, prompting calls for greater protections for pregnant women and new mothers. The brutal nature of the crime and the calculated actions of the perpetrators underscored the need for increased awareness and support for individuals at risk of falling victim to such predators. The sentencing of Clarisa Figueroa and her co-conspirators brought some closure to the tragic chapter, but also served as a reminder of the importance of remaining vigilant in protecting vulnerable members of society.
